Morrisville is a borough located in Bucks County, Pennsylvania. Morrisville has a 2025 population of 9,645. Morrisville is currently declining at a rate of -0.31% annually and its population has decreased by -1.53%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 9,795 in 2020.

The average household income in Morrisville is $106,852 with a poverty rate of 11.28%.The median age in Morrisville is 39.5 years: 37.8 years for males, and 40.9 years for females.

Demographics

The racial composition of Morrisville includes 72% White, 8.15% Black or African American, 6.08% other race, 4.85% Asian, and smaller percentages for Native American and multiracial populations.

Economics and Income Statistics

Morrisville's average per capita income is $59,500. Household income levels show a median of $94,126. The poverty rate stands at 11.28%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
